Top Banner
Woensdag 25 november 2009 Architectuur als levend mechanisme: De ECO-architectuur Hans Koopman Rob Poels
27

Lac 2009 eco architectuur

Jun 14, 2015

Download

Business

Dan Kamminga
Welcome message from author
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
Page 1: Lac 2009 eco architectuur

Woensdag 25 november 2009

Architectuur als levend

mechanisme:

De ECO-architectuur

Hans Koopman

Rob Poels

Page 2: Lac 2009 eco architectuur

Woensdag 25 november 2009

Inhoud

• Even voorstellen: Rob Hans

• We doen het goed

• Of toch niet?

• Wat is er aan de hand: van stolling tot chaos

• Een Eco-architectuur!?

• Complementaire benadering

• UVIT als praktijkcase

Page 3: Lac 2009 eco architectuur

Woensdag 25 november 2009

Rob PoelsHans Koopman

Page 4: Lac 2009 eco architectuur

Woensdag 25 november 2009

Het gaat goed met ons vak!

MSc IT Architecture

DYA®

Page 5: Lac 2009 eco architectuur

Woensdag 25 november 2009

En toch weten we niet altijd de

aansluiting te vinden….

Page 6: Lac 2009 eco architectuur

Woensdag 25 november 2009

Hebben we wel antwoord op:

Grotere dynamiek binnen en tussen

organisaties?

Fusies,SamenwerkingsverbandenReorganisatiesFaillicementenOvernames

Océ – CanonUnileverTNTGM – OpelAbn-Amro – Fortis – HBD

Page 7: Lac 2009 eco architectuur

Woensdag 25 november 2009

Hebben we wel antwoord op:

Organisatiegrenzen die vervagen?

Page 8: Lac 2009 eco architectuur

Woensdag 25 november 2009

Hebben we wel antwoord op:

Onontkoombare technologische

ontwikkelingen?

Page 9: Lac 2009 eco architectuur

Woensdag 25 november 2009

Hebben we wel antwoord op:

Toenemende complexiteit IT-

Omgeving?

Page 10: Lac 2009 eco architectuur

Woensdag 25 november 2009

Dillemma’s

• Valt dit nog te engineeren?

• Lossen we dit op door te werken aan meer

kennis, betere spelers en strakkere KPI’s in te

stellen?

• Of moeten we de complexiteit niet gewoon

accepteren?

Page 11: Lac 2009 eco architectuur

Woensdag 25 november 2009

Chaos theorieR

espo

ns o

p ex

tern

e pr

ikke

ls

Stolling Dynamischevenwicht

Chaos

Page 12: Lac 2009 eco architectuur

Woensdag 25 november 2009

Chaos theorie

Stolling Dynamisch

evenwicht

Chaos

Engineering

of/of

Zelfstandige

naamwoorden

Lineair

Harde grenzen

Procedures om

te richten

Controle

Effectiviteit

en/en

Werkwoorden

Cyclisch

Troebele genzen

Identiteit om

te richten

Transparantie

Redundantie

Page 13: Lac 2009 eco architectuur

Woensdag 25 november 2009

Een ECO-architectuur

Producent Reducent

Consument

Page 14: Lac 2009 eco architectuur

Woensdag 25 november 2009

• Consument = Processen in een organisatie

• Processen zijn dynamisch en in de tijd

veranderlijk

�Proces optimalisaties op basis van monitoring

�Denk aan BPEL

Consument

Page 15: Lac 2009 eco architectuur

Woensdag 25 november 2009

• Producent = (web) services

• Services zijn stabiel in de tijd

�Services aanroepen op basis van standaard

protocollen

�Idealiter passen de services zich aan aan de

omgeving (vgl gaming industrie)

Producent

Page 16: Lac 2009 eco architectuur

Woensdag 25 november 2009

• Reducent = functionaliteiten/functionalrissen

die services en processen verwijderen die er

niet meer toe doen

�Redundantie in services en processen mag

�Door monitoring wordt de kwaliteit van de

producenten behoordeeld

Reducent

Page 17: Lac 2009 eco architectuur

Woensdag 25 november 2009

�Monitoring services

�Veel gebruikt: extra investeren in continuïteit

�Niet of weinig gebruikt: aanpassen of afsterven

�Monitoring processen

�Voortijdig afgebroken: onderzoeken oorzaak

�Doorlooptijden gaan omhoog: proces

herontwerpen

Reducent

Page 18: Lac 2009 eco architectuur

Woensdag 25 november 2009

• Uitsluiten van

onvoorspelbaar gedrag

• Onderhoud is ingreep op

het systeem

• Modelleren van artefacten /

gewenst gedrag

• Inspelen op

omgevingsgedrag

• Onderhoud is onderdeel

van het systeem

• Modelleren van

interfaces/interacties

Stolling Dynamisch

evenwicht

Chaos

Engineering

ECO-benadering

Page 19: Lac 2009 eco architectuur

Woensdag 25 november 2009

ECO benadering in de praktijk…

UVIT

Page 20: Lac 2009 eco architectuur

Woensdag 25 november 2009

Page 21: Lac 2009 eco architectuur

Woensdag 25 november 2009

Processen

Page 22: Lac 2009 eco architectuur

Woensdag 25 november 2009

Distributie

Page 23: Lac 2009 eco architectuur

Woensdag 25 november 2009

Service verlening

Page 24: Lac 2009 eco architectuur

Woensdag 25 november 2009

Producent

Page 25: Lac 2009 eco architectuur

Woensdag 25 november 2009

Consument

Page 26: Lac 2009 eco architectuur

Woensdag 25 november 2009

Reducent

Page 27: Lac 2009 eco architectuur

Woensdag 25 november 2009

Wil je een korte beschrijving van de UVIT informatiearchitectuur hebben?

Stuur even een mailtje naar

[email protected]